Tourist & Travel Services near Willows, CA

Companies

Tourist & Travel Services - Willows CA

  • Motel 6 Willows
    452 Humboldt Avenue, Willows, CA 95988
    QuoteThe room is clean and quick, and the view from the room is excellent. ...